Johnnydart, one of my main reasons for going with the Scarebird setup was to keep my small pattern rallyes. Have you tried pricing (or even finding) the small pattern Kelsey-Hayes disc setup? And even if you DO find one, rotors and calipers have gotten scarcer than hen's teeth. It just didn't make sense to me to spend all that money on parts that will end up being just cores with new ones rarely available and expensive these days.
Mr. Bill, I noticed right away that the Celebrity calipers would have to be reversed right to left to get the bleeder screw on top, and if I remember right it says that in the directions too, once I finally got around to reading them.
